Theo Prodromidis, Towards a collective practice of interpersonal care
Evenings with WHW Akademija
No items found.
LECTURE ON ZOOM PLATFORM
04/05/2020 AT 17.00

Theo Prodromidis has prepared a two-day program consisting of a public lecture and a workshop just for the students of WHW Akademija on the following day. He took his personal history of art practice´scollaborative schemes and working relationships as a starting point and took a reflexive look at it through the challenges of aesthetic production of the last 10 years of crisis (for and from Athens), culminating this year with the situation related to Covid-19. This will result in introducing the group to a series of grounding fields relating to notions and practices of solidarity, pedagogy and citizenship. By navigating through our own biographies, we will examine the ways to relate and cohabit with the ones around us, in proximity or distance.

Public lecture Towards a collective practice of interpersonal care (done and to be done) in online format will explore the notion of care and how we respond to noticing, participating, sharing, active listening, companioning, complimenting, comforting, hoping, forgiving, and accepting and how to find forms to share this with the rest of the group.
